DB2 Web QueryAdd-on: Active Reports
DB2 Web QueryAdd-on: Active Reports
DB2 Web QueryAdd-on: Active Reports
Self-contained analytical reports Delivered to users via email* or browser
Users interact with the data on the report w/o being connected to a network infrastructure
Intuitive built-in controls Sorting, Filtering, Visualization,
Charting, Dynamic Roll-ups Export to HTML, CSV or Excel Export Charts to Word, Excel, or PowerPoint
Great for mobile users that are not connected or even defined as a user on the System i

• DB2 Web Query is sold by IBM and their resellers ONLY
• DB2 Web Query is an internal query and reporting tool• It is NOT (nor sold as) a BI application
• As an IBM customer, if you had Query/400, you get a copy of DB2 Web Query• Ordered by IBM or reseller• # of users depends on size of machine
• IBM (and their resellers) make $$$ by selling:• Support (maintenance)• More Users• Add on Features: OLAP, Active Reports
DB2 Web QueryDoes Information Builders sell DB2 Web Query?

So exactly what functionality does WebFOCUS
provide that DB2 Web Query doesn’t have?
WebFOCUS has all the functionality that DB2 Web Query provides, plus:
• Ability to create Self-service applications• Ability to create Dashboards (five types)• Satisfies ANY reporting requirement• Data Visualization• Report Distribution• Connectivity to anything in your enterprise
• ERP, SCM, CRM, legacy data, RDBMS• Tie Action to Information
